WebThe National Children’s Forest. This spectacular 3,400-acre area of forest is named for the trees planted there in the wake of the 1970 Bear Fire. Each one bears the name of a child and is part of some of the most beautiful backcountry in the San Bernardino Mountains. The purpose of the Children’s Forest is to provide opportunities for ... WebThe Children’s Forest trail is an all weather surface loop trail that begins and ends in the monument area of the National Children’s Forest. This is a universally accessible trail with grades of less than 3%. On April 27, 1971 an arson fire blackened the 1176 acres now known as the National Children’s Forest. ... WebGetting to the Cashel Forest Walk Trailhead. To get to the Cashel Forest Trailhead from Drymen, take the B837 North to Balmaha. The road follows the east shores of Loch Lomond. In under 11.3 km you’ll arrive at the Cashel Native Forest car park, it is signposted and on the right. Parking is £3.00.

WebThe Forest Trail follows an old roadway on the western side of the park running northeast to southwest. The trail’s starting point is 3/4 mile northeast of the office on Spur 23 West. The trail ends where it intersects the road between the office and baseball park. WebSep 20, 2024 · Cheesequake State Park – Matawan. With saltwater marshes, freshwater swamps, open fields, and a hardwood forest, this state park boasts five well-marked hiking trails ranging from easy to moderate. The beginner yellow trail is a shaded loop with boardwalks, stairs, and views of Hooks Creek Lake. The more moderate red, green, and …
